Baby Aspirin during pregnancyFrom: Stephanie (anonymous@obgyn.net)Mon, 17 Jun 2002 10:51:53 -0500 (CDT)
I have learned that it is helpful for many pcos-ers to take baby aspirin (81 mg) once a day during early pregnancy to prevent blood clotting. Do you have info or links that explain when this should be stopped? I have heard that in the last trimester, no aspirin should be consumed, but how long before that can I continue? Thanks!
